    INA-  Baghdad

     
    The Ministry of Oil announced on Wednesday the finalization of draft partnership contracts with private sector companies specialized in the manufacture of liquid gas systems for vehicles.
     
    The ministry's spokesman, Assem Jihad, said in a statement, received by the Iraqi News Agency (INA): "The ministry has finalized the draft participation contracts with private sector companies specialized in the manufacture of liquid gas systems for vehicles, which will work in cooperation with State Company For Gas Filling & Services in increasing the number of technical workshops to add the system in Baghdad and the provinces."

    He stressed "the importance of expanding the use of the gas system for vehicles by citizens, because of its great economic and environmental returns, which are represented in converting the fuel used in vehicles into clean fuel that is less expensive and harmful to the safety of society, because it is environmentally friendly and relieves the citizen of the exorbitant financial expenses of using gasoline fuel."
    For his part, the general director of the State Company for Gas Filling & Services, Anmar Ali Hussein, said that "the committee in charge has completed the preparation of the economic feasibility study and the mechanisms for contracting with specialized companies."
     
    It is noteworthy that the Cabinet issued its decision No. 360 of 2017, which includes in paragraph 5 of it, authorizing the Ministry of Oil / State Company for Gas Filling & Services to enter into partnership contracts with specialized companies to expand the workshops for adding these systems and establishing liquid gas filling stations throughout Iraq.
